UPDATE: The security alert at playing fields in east Belfast has ended - almost 24 hours after it began.

The principal of a primary school that was forced to shut due to a security alert has said he is shocked and angered by the disruption to education.

"We're now having to explain to our children that some people, because they don't agree with a particular sport being played across the road from our school, that they can't exercise their right to come to school today," said Lough View's principal Sean Spillane.that the alert had disrupted his pupils' education and stopped people in the area from going to work.

The alert began on Monday evening and police and Army technical officers attended the scene on Church Road, Castlereagh on the outskirts of east Belfast.
